If you are experiencing issues with an Intellok safe keypad, a full replacement is often only necessary if hardware damage has occurred. Most operational failures can be resolved with verified maintenance steps. Verified Quick Fixes

Before purchasing a new unit, try these verified troubleshooting steps:

Battery Replacement: Ensure you are using a brand-name 9V alkaline battery (specifically Duracell or Energizer). Low-quality or non-alkaline batteries often lack the stable amperage required to engage the lock solenoid, even if they power the keypad lights.

Connection Check: If the keypad is unresponsive, the internal wire may have come loose. Carefully pull the keypad housing away from the door to inspect the plug and cable for any visible tears or disconnections.

Clear Lockout Mode: Entering the wrong code too many times will trigger a lockout. Wait at least 15–20 minutes without pressing any buttons before trying again. Replacing the Keypad (Step-by-Step) intellok safe keypad replacement verified

If you're dealing with an Intellok safe keypad replacement , the process is straightforward but requires attention to detail—especially regarding internal connections. Replacing the keypad is often necessary when battery terminals break or the electronic display fails. Verification Before Replacement

Before buying a new unit, verify if the current keypad is actually broken. Many "dead" keypads are simply underpowered. Battery Power

: Electronic locks often fail to actuate if the battery is low, even if the lights still blink. Always test with a brand-new Duracell 9V alkaline

battery, as other brands often lack the consistent peak current needed to pull the solenoid. Manual Override : If you are locked out, check for a hidden mechanical override key Keypad Replacement Steps Open the Safe

: Access to the internal lock pack is usually required. If the safe is locked and the keypad is dead, you may need a locksmith. Remove the Back Panel

: Open the safe door and remove the interior cover to reveal the internal lock mechanism and wiring. Disconnect the Keypad A verified Intellok safe keypad replacement gives you

: Unplug the wire (often a ribbon cable) from the back of the keypad and feed it through the spindle hole toward the inside of the door. Unmount the Unit

: Pop off any manufacturer stickers (like an SG or Intellok tab) to find the screws holding the keypad to the safe face. Install the New Keypad

: Mount the new unit, feed the wire through, and reconnect it to the lock pack. Standard replacements like the Lagard Basic 2

are often compatible if the original Intellok unit isn't available. Test Before Closing : Enter the factory code 1-2-3-4-5-6 ) with the door to verify the bolts retract. Code Reset (Post-Installation)
